Memory-

A sweet moment of forever,

 In the palm of my hand.

A delicious breath of eternity,

Flows down my arm.


Forever young in my mind,

Mingled in the present,

Alive in the past,

Ancient in the present.


Monument to fears of old,

A collection of faded joy,

Album of expired sorrows,

A gallery of emotions,

Lost in yesterday.
